WebApr 5, 2024 · The easiest way to open the Device Manager on any version of Windows is by pressing Windows Key + R, typing devmgmt.msc, and pressing Enter. On Windows 10 or 8, you can also right-click in the bottom-left corner of your screen and select Device Manager. WebFor Windows 7 and earlier, start with step 1: Click Start, point to All Programs, point to. Accessories, and then click Command Prompt. At a command prompt, type the following command , and then press ENTER: set devmgr_show_nonpresent_devices=1.
